Q: How do retroreflective sensors detect objects in industrial environments?
A: Retroreflective sensors use photoelectric technology to emit a light beam that reflects off a target object and returns to the sensors receiver. Detection occurs when the reflected light is interrupted or returned, enabling accurate object detection even in challenging industrial settings.

Q: What are the advantages of a digital switching output and adjustable sensitivity?
A: A digital switching output provides clear on/off signals for straightforward integration into industrial control systems. Adjustable sensitivity allows you to fine-tune the sensor for specific object sizes or environmental conditions, ensuring dependable detection and adaptability for various applications.
